The large expanse of the Queen’s Park playing field was encircled by booths preparing dishes mouthwatering dishes at the Barbados Food & Wine and Rum Festival Sizzle Street this afternoon.
Locals and tourists alike indulged in the various foods served up.
Some sat at tables while others sat on the grass enjoying the outdoor dining experience where dishes ranging from pork, bacon cakes, pork kebabs, barbecued ribs, breadfruit fish cakes to the more popular pudding and souse and macaroni pie were on offer. (LK)
